Samie Elishi has broken her silence about her split from Love Island beau Tom Clare.The former flames met on the most recent series of the show and went on to make it all the way to the final. While things between them seemed to be going well, six weeks on from leaving the South African villa, Tom and Samie have officially called things quits.
Following speculation that they’d ended their romance, Tom, 23, confirmed the news yesterday as he penned to his Instagram Story: “Didn’t think I’d be writing this but me & Samie have one [our] separate ways… we are still on good terms & I have nothing but love and respect for her. I’m gutted it’s come to an end but I truly wish Samie the best”.
He ended the statement with a red heart emoji. Now Samie herself has spoken out via social media, and shared a statement on Instagram on Thursday.
She said: "Really didn't want to have to write an Instagram Story on this but the comments and messages I have been getting since Tom posted this story yesterday is just not fair. "I will be speaking about everything soon but at the moment the time isn't right (which I will also explain) Thank you for the kind messages they don't go unnoticed," with a red heart emoji.
Their break up comes after Samie recently admitted that she went on Love Island to get exposure, rather than find love.
